I am applying for a PR as EEU citizen, in the guidance notes under evidence of working, it requires the following:
- Letter from each employer confirming the dates you/your sponsor worked for them,
salary/wages, normal hours of work, and the reason the employment ended (if relevant)
- Wage slips and/or bank statements showing receipt of wages (this must cover each job you
have/your sponsor has held during the relevant qualifying period)
- P60s for each year in which you were/your sponsor was employed.
- Would I need to submit all of those or one is sufficient?
- Unfortunately, a company I worked for in 2012 no long exists and I cannot seem to get hold of them. I could only find the employment contract and a few payslips (and I have my bank statements for that period), but no P45/P60 for that year. Do you think that would be sufficient?

Many thanks
